Enterprise Services Manager

 

Why We Have This Role

As an Enterprise Services Manager of a team of Technical Account Managers (TAMs) you will combine a passion for developing and leading teams, solving complex business problems and ensuring delivery of top tier customer support. Youâll also drive customer obsession by helping our clients unlock the most value from our products and services. Working closely with our Global Head of Enterprise Services and other cross functional leaders, you will help establish a strong network that enhances the customer experience for our largest enterprise clients. You should have a strong interest in (1) building high performing teams; (2) driving operational best practices; (3) expanding Experience Management adoption; and (4) providing a world class customer experience to our enterprise customers.

Things Youâll Do

  • Lead a team of Technical Account Managers (TAMs) to deliver high touch technical support and technology configuration services. This team drives program adoption and usage, as well as technical thought partnership and strategy.
  • Manage team capacity, forecasting, financial performance and resource allocation
  • Help hire, onboard, train, and retain top talent
  • Provide coaching and mentorship to guide career development for TAMs
  • Work closely with cross-functional counterparts to identify and drive initiatives to improve the customer experience.
  • Collaborate with the Product team, bringing unique insights on real-world client needs to shape Product roadmap.
  • Communicate team impact and results to key partners and act as an advocate for the team within Qualtrics and to external customers.
  • Maintain an expert knowledge of the Qualtrics XM Platform and other products and drive improvements to product quality/customer experience.

 

What Weâre Looking For On Your Resume

  • 8+ years of professional experience
  • 3-5 years of direct client management experience
  • Prior leadership experience - including building and leading teams
  • MBA or advanced degree from a top-tier university

The Qualtrics Hybrid Work Model: Our hybrid work model is elegantly simple: we all gather in the office three days a week; Mondays and Thursdays, plus one day selected by your organizational leader. These purposeful in-person days in thoughtfully designed offices help us do our best work and harness the power of collaboration and innovation. For the rest of the week, work where you want, owning the integration of work and life.
